Angiotensin, specifically angiotensin II, binds to many receptors in the body to affect several systems. It can increase blood pressure by constricting the blood vessels.
In the adrenal glands, angiotensin stimulates aldosterone production. This hormone causes the body to retain sodium, causing increased water re-absorption to increase the volume of blood. It increases GFR.
